DEN LILLE HAVFRUE

( The Little Mermaid ). On the Langelinie promenade, this somewhat overhyped 1913 statue commemorates Hans Christian Andersen's lovelorn creation, and is the subject of hundreds of travel posters. Donated to the city by Carl Jacobsen, the son of the founder of Carlsberg Breweries, the innocent …
